Abercynon to Longcross by train

A train trip from Abercynon to Longcross takes about 4hrs on average, covering roughly 118 miles (191 kilometres). With around 25 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£28.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Abercynon to Longcross start from as little as £28.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Abercynon to Longcross start from £52.80 one way, or £91.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Abercynon to Longcross are available for £149.50 one way, or £299.00 return

Station Facilities and Services

Abercynon Station may not boast a bustling ticket office, but it simplifies the process with modern ticket machines that support quick and easy ticket collections. These machines have been cleverly designed to accommodate all travelers, offering accessible ticketing with support for major debit and credit cards, although they don't accept cash. For tech-savvy travelers, the presence of smartcard validators ensures a seamless transition between different parts of the journey.

The station’s facilities cater to everyday commuter needs. While there are no dedicated waiting rooms, there is ample seating available. Travelers can rest assured with the availability of CCTV and help points, providing a safe and informed environment. Unfortunately, the station lacks luggage storage, refreshment facilities, and luxury lounges, but travelers can rely on the extensive transport links for their onward journeys or plan stops at nearby amenities.

Accessibility and Support

Abercynon aims to provide accessible travel to as many passengers as possible. It offers step-free access and ramps with handrails are available for both platforms, classifying it as Category B2 on the accessibility scale. Although wheelchair availability and waiting rooms are absent, the station compensates with accessible parking options. The staff helpdesk and comprehensive customer information through screens and announcements ensure that travelers with different needs are catered to.

Facilities and Amenities at Longcross

Despite its rustic charm, travelers should note that Longcross Station is not a hub of bustling activity. It features no ticket office or ticket machines, so it is necessary to purchase a Permit to Travel at the station and exchange it for a ticket on board the train. The station does have smartcard validators for those who commit to using smartcards. While there are no direct staff services present, there are help points available for customer queries and support.

For those needing accessibility support, it's important to mention that the station has step-free access only via a footpath through Surrey Heath Wood, which could be challenging due to its uneven and unlit nature. Heated waiting rooms on both platforms do provide some comfort, whether you're bracing for the cold or taking a leisurely break.

Unfortunately, Longcross lacks basic amenities such as toilets, refreshment facilities, or shops. However, public Wi-Fi is available for those who wish to connect to the internet during their waiting times.

Onward Travel Options

When it comes to onward travel, options at Longcross are somewhat limited. There are no replacement bus services and accessible taxis are unavailable.
